Title: To authorize the Director of Development to execute an amendment or supplement to the existing Reimbursement Agreement dated September 17, 2009 between the City and NWD Investments, LLC to provide for the acquisition of property interests within and around the area at the northeast corner of Front Street and Nationwide Boulevard; and to declare an emergency.
Explanation

Background: Columbus City Council passed Ordinances 2356-98 and 2357-98 on September 14, 1998, and Ordinances 2092-01 and 2093-01 passed December 17, 2001, creating four tax increment financing (TIF) districts in and around the former Ohio Pen site, and pursuant to Ordinance 1554-2008 the City and NWD Investments, LLC or its affiliates (NWD entered into a Reimbursement Agreements dated September 17, 2009 in connection with those TIF districts. The attached Ordinance authorizes an amendment or supplement to that Agreement authorizing related acquisitions of property or interests therein in support of, the further redevelopment in that area.

Fiscal Impact: No City funding is required for this legislation.
